Jankovic reaches Auckland semis
Serbian top seed Jelena Jankovic dispatched former champion Eleni Daniilidou to book her place in the semi-finals of the Auckland Classic.
The world number 12 showed no signs of the jet lag that hindered her earlier matches as she beat Daniilidou 6-3 6-4.
Jankovic faces Frenchwoman Camille Pin for a place in the final after Pin saw off compatriot Emilie Loit 6-3 6-3.
On the other side of the draw, American Jill Craybas meets Russian Vera Zvonareva in the other semi-final.
Craybas defeated Argentine veteran Paola Suarez 6-3 7-6 (7-4) to reach the last four in Auckland for the first time.
Zvonareva, the fifth seed, advanced after Frenchwoman Virginie Razzano retired with Zvonareva leading 7-5 2-0.
"Today was a great match, so many great points and Eleni played so good," said Jankovic.
"There were some close calls which could have gone either way and I'm happy today that they went my way."
